Pricing covers my labor only. You buy materials direct from Home Depot at retail — no markup, no "materials handling" fee. I'll hand you the shopping list before the job.
30 min on-site. I count rooms, measure walls, and check for any wet spots that need to dry first.
Labor estimate next day. If you want help picking colors, I'll spend 30 min with you at Sherwin-Williams.
Move furniture to center, drop-cloth floors, plastic on cabinets and built-ins.
Patch, sand, prime, two coats. Usually 1–4 days depending on size.
Cut lines checked, drop-cloths up, furniture back.
Both work. SW is what I default to because of the Pompano store hours and contractor pricing. If you have a specific BM color, I'll match it.
Only the rooms I'm actively painting that day. With low-VOC paint, you can stay in the other rooms.
Touch-dry in 1 hour, recoat at 4 hours, fully cured at 30 days. I won't put furniture against a freshly painted wall for at least 48 hours.
